基于51单片机的交通灯原理图(硬件设计、软件设计、工作原理和应用场景)
摘要
交通灯是城市道路上必不可少的设施,它起到了引导车辆和行人交通的重要作用。本文以基于51单片机的交通灯原理图为中心,从硬件设计、软件设计、工作原理和应用场景四个方面进行详细阐述。
一、硬件设计
在基于51单片机的交通灯原理图中,硬件设计是至关重要的一部分。首先需要确定所需元器件,包括LED灯、电阻、电容等。然后根据实际需求进行线路连接,并添加适当的保护电路以确保系统稳定性和安全性。最后通过PCB布局和焊接完成整个硬件设计。
在硬件设计过程中还需要考虑供电方式、信号输入输出等因素,并合理选择元器件参数以满足实际需求。同时还需要注意线路布局合理性,减少干扰和噪声对系统正常工作的影响。
二、软件设计
基于51单片机的交通灯原理图涉及到软件程序编写,在这一部分主要是通过C语言来实现控制逻辑。首先需要了解并熟悉51单片机的指令集和编程方式,然后根据交通灯的工作原理设计相应的程序。
软件设计包括状态切换、定时器控制、输入输出控制等功能。通过合理设置定时器和中断,实现交通灯状态的切换和时间控制。同时还需要考虑异常情况处理,如故障检测和报警等。
三、工作原理
基于51单片机的交通灯原理图是通过程序控制LED灯进行状态切换来实现不同方向车辆和行人交通信号的显示。其工作原理主要分为以下几个步骤:
1. 初始化:对各个引脚进行初始化设置,并启动定时器。
2. 状态切换:根据预设时间间隔,在不同方向之间进行状态切换,例如红绿黄三种颜色信号。
3. 输入检测:通过外部传感器或按钮输入检测当前道路上是否有车辆或行人等待过马路。
4. 异常处理:当发生异常情况(如故障)时,及时报警并采取相应措施以确保安全性。
四、应用场景
基于51单片机的交通灯原理图广泛应用于城市道路、高速公路、停车场等交通场景。通过合理设置交通灯的工作模式和时间间隔,可以有效引导车辆和行人交通,提高道路安全性。
此外,基于51单片机的交通灯原理图还可以与其他系统进行联动,如监控系统、智能交通管理系统等。通过数据传输和信息共享,实现更加智能化的交通管理。
五、总结
本文详细阐述了基于51单片机的交通灯原理图的硬件设计、软件设计、工作原理和应用场景。通过合理设置元器件参数和编写程序逻辑,可以实现稳定可靠地控制LED灯状态切换,并有效引导车辆和行人交通。
未来随着科技发展,基于51单片机的交通灯原理图将会进一步融入智能化系统中,并为城市道路安全提供更多便利与保障。
责任编辑:David
【免责声明】
1、本文内容、数据、图表等来源于网络引用或其他公开资料,版权归属原作者、原发表出处。若版权所有方对本文的引用持有异议,请联系拍明芯城(marketing@iczoom.com),本方将及时处理。
2、本文的引用仅供读者交流学习使用,不涉及商业目的。
3、本文内容仅代表作者观点,拍明芯城不对内容的准确性、可靠性或完整性提供明示或暗示的保证。读者阅读本文后做出的决定或行为,是基于自主意愿和独立判断做出的,请读者明确相关结果。
4、如需转载本方拥有版权的文章,请联系拍明芯城(marketing@iczoom.com)注明“转载原因”。未经允许私自转载拍明芯城将保留追究其法律责任的权利。
拍明芯城拥有对此声明的最终解释权。